The website japanmotorspares.co.za appears to be a scam. Here are the reasons: 1. Lack of Detailed Information: The website provides very limited information about the company, its location, and its history. Legitimate businesses usually have detailed 'About Us' sections. 2. Suspicious Contact Information: The use of a generic email address (info@japanmotorspares.co.za) and a mobile number (+27 73 319 0085) as the primary contact information is unprofessional and raises concerns about the legitimacy of the business. 3. Unrealistic Claims: The website makes bold claims about having a wide range of high-quality products, including engines and gearboxes, with free shipping and 100% safety. These claims are often used by scam websites to lure in customers. 4. Lack of Reviews or Testimonials: There are no customer reviews or testimonials on the website, which is unusual for a business that claims to have been operating for over 30 years. 5. Limited Payment Options: The website does not provide information about accepted payment methods, which is a red flag for e-commerce sites. 6. Poor Website Design: The website has a basic and unprofessional design, which is often a characteristic of scam websites. 7. Domain Age: The domain was registered relatively recently, which is another red flag for a business claiming to have a long history. 8. Lack of Company Registration Information: Legitimate businesses usually provide details about their registration, such as company registration numbers and regulatory compliance. 9. Unverifiable Stock Information: The detailed list of stock items, including specific engine and gearbox models, is not verifiable and could be a tactic to create a sense of legitimacy. 10. No Physical Address: The absence of a physical address for the business is a common characteristic of scam websites. Based on these factors, it is advisable to exercise caution and conduct further research before engaging with this website or making any purchases."
